Wine On The Roof 2019
Wine On The Roof…Dine on The Roof did not let the threat of rain halt their plans. Moving into the patios at Westfield, in what was Charming Charlies, the show went on beautifully. Attendees got a chance to experience a variety of food from several restaurants in town that were paired with some of the best wines from local winemakers, all in the name of charity. Proceeds from this event went to the WiSH Education Foundation which provides opportunities to the William S. Hart School District not afforded by state funds. A good time was had by all as they learned about the various dishes and wine pairings. A huge thank you to all the sponsors, restaurants, and winemakers for making this event so great.
